The ClubSwan 50 World Championship is an annual international sailing regatta for ClubSwan 50 One Design built by Nautor Swan, they are organized by the host club on behalf of the International ClubSwan 50 Class Association and recognized by World Sailing, the sports IOC recognized governing body. The event was often held as part of multiple class events such as Swan's own brand regattas and pinnacle yachting events.

Year | Gold | Silver | Bronze | Ref. |
---|---|---|---|---|
2019 18 Boats | RUS - Skorpios Dmitry Rybolovlev (RUS) Fernando Echávarri (ESP) U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N | GBR - Perhonen Ross Warburton (GBR) | GER - Niramo Sonke Meier Sawatski (GER) | [1] [2] [3] |
2020 Scarlino 15 Boats | GER 5016 - HATARI Marcus Brennecke (GER) U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N UNKNOWN | GER 5009 - NIRAMO Sonke Meier Sawatzki (GER) | RUS 5007 - SKORPIDI Dmitry Rybolovlev (RUS) | [4] |
2021 | GER 5016 - HATARI Marcus Brennecke (GER) | GER 5005 - EARLYBIRD (276) Hendrik Brandis (GER) | ITA 5027 - CUORDILEONE Leonardo Ferragamo (ITA) | [5] |
2022 Valencia 16 Boats | ITA - Cuordileone Leonardo Ferragamo (ITA) | GER - Earlybird Hendrik Brandis (GER) | BEL - Balthasar Louis Balcaen (BEL) | [6] |
Oy Nautor AB is a Finnish producer of luxury sailing yachts, based in Jakobstad. It is known for its Nautor's Swan range of yachts models. The company was founded in 1966 by Pekka Koskenkylä.
The Farr 40 is a 40-foot one-design sailboat designed by Farr Yacht Design in 1996 following after the Mumm 30. It was originally designed as a one design class but had some compromises in design to rate under the International Measurement System (IMS) rule. The class has held World Sailing class status since 1997.

Swan 36 is a fin keeled, fiberglass constructed masthead sloop first manufactured by Nautor's Swan in 1967. The first Swan sailing yacht ever produced by the firm, it was designed to serve recreationally but also compete in the One Ton Cup.

The ClubSwan 50 is a Finnish sailboat that was designed by Juan Kouyoumdjian as a one design and International Rating Certificate racer-cruiser, first built in 2015. The interior was designed by Michele Bönan.
